How To Do Simulation?

How to Conduct a Simulation

  1. Describe the possible outcomes.
  2. Link each outcome to one or more random numbers.
  3. Choose a source of random numbers.
  4. Choose a random number.
  5. Based on the random number, note the “simulated” outcome.
  6. Repeat steps 4 and 5 multiple times; preferably, until the outcomes show a stable pattern.

Contents

How do I start simulation?

To start the simulation, click the Start/Continue button on the debugger toolbar. Set breakpoints. Run the simulation step by step. Continue the simulation to the next breakpoint or end.

What are the 5 steps of a simulation?

In this section:

  1. Introduction.
  2. General Procedure.
  3. Step 1: Planning the Study.
  4. Step 2: Defining the System.
  5. Step 3: Building the Model.
  6. Step 4: Conducting Experiments.
  7. Step 5: Analyzing the Output.
  8. Step 6: Reporting the Results.

What do we do in simulation?

In a simulation, we perform experiments on a model of the real system, rather than the real system itself. We do this because it is faster, cheaper, or safer to perform experiments on the model.

How do I run a VHDL code?

Create VHDL Source

  1. Click New Source in the New Project Wizard to add to one new source to your project.
  2. Type in the file name counter.
  3. Select VHDL Module as the source type in the New Source Dialog box.
  4. Verify that the Add to Project checkbox is selected.
  5. Click Next.
  6. Define the ports for your VHDL source.

How do you run in ModelSim?

  1. In order to run your simulation, you need to create a project. Click File -> New -> Project.
  2. Click on Add Existing File as shown in the picture to the right.
  3. To start your simulation, click on Simulate in the Menu Bar, then click Start Simulation.
  4. Here is your waveform window.

What is basic simulation?

1.1 THE NATURE OF SIMULATION. • Simulation: Imitate the operations of a facility or process, usually via computer. – What’s being simulated is the system. – To study system, often make assumptions/approximations, both.

What are simulation exercises?

A simulation exercises is a fully simulated, interactive exercise that tests the capability of an organization or other entity to respond to a simulated emergency, disaster or crisis situation. Simulation exercises are normally run as field exercises and include a scenario that is as close to reality as possible.

What is simulation experiment?

A computer experiment or simulation experiment is an experiment used to study a computer simulation, also referred to as an in silico system. This area includes computational physics, computational chemistry, computational biology and other similar disciplines.

What is simulation example?

The definition of a simulation is a model or representative example of something. When you create a computer program that is intended to model flying a plane, this is an example of a simulation. An imitation; a sham.The use of a computer to calculate, by means of extrapolation, the effect of a given physical process.

Which software is best for simulation?

Here are the best simulation software of 2018.

  • AnyLogic. AnyLogic is a simulation modeling tool created by the AnyLogic Company.
  • MATLAB. MATLAB is perhaps the most popular simulation software on this list.
  • SimScale.
  • Simul8.
  • COMSOL Multiphysics.
  • Simulink.
  • Arena.

How is simulation used in the real world?

Simulation is used in many contexts, such as simulation of technology for performance tuning or optimizing, safety engineering, testing, training, education, and video games. Simulation is also used with scientific modelling of natural systems or human systems to gain insight into their functioning, as in economics.

What is FPGA programming?

What is FPGA programming? A field-programmable gate array (FPGA) is an electronic device that includes digital logic circuitry you can program to customize its functionality.An FPGA that also includes a processor on the device is called a system-on-chip, or SoC FPGA.

What is VHDL used for?

What Is VHDL? Very High-Speed Integrated Circuit Hardware Description Language (VHDL) is a description language used to describe hardware. It is utilized in electronic design automation to express mixed-signal and digital systems, such as ICs (integrated circuits) and FPGA (field-programmable gate arrays).

Why work is empty in ModelSim?

Else ModelSim might be simply compiling an empty file – which would, of course, yield nothing to add to a library. If that’s not the case, try this: Delete old work library. Use File > Change Directory to change to your working directory.

Do file for ModelSim?

What are DO files? DO files are an automation tool in ModelSim. This tool allows ModelSim to automatically assign values to inputs in a simulation, run or restart the simulation, or even automatically verify circuits.

Is ModelSim student edition free?

ModelSim PE Student Edition is a free download of the industry leading ModelSim HDL simulator for use by students in their academic coursework. – Support for both VHDL and Verilog designs (non-mixed).

What are the seven steps in simulation?

The 7 steps

  1. Determine the goals. Setting the goal is the first step to be taken.
  2. Perform an appropriate data collection.
  3. Build the model.
  4. Validate the built model.
  5. Perform simulation and collect the results.
  6. Analyze the results.
  7. Make the final documentation.

What is a simulation process?

Process simulation is a model-based representation of chemical, physical, biological, and other technical processes and unit operations in software.The goal of a process simulation is to find optimal conditions for a process. This is essentially an optimization problem which has to be solved in an iterative process.

How are simulation tools used?

Simulation software is used widely to design equipment so that the final product will be as close to design specs as possible without expensive in process modification.In addition to imitating processes to see how they behave under different conditions, simulations are also used to test new theories.

What is simulation training examples?

Driving simulation – involves reproducing realistic car movements, traffic, driveways and weather conditions. Air traffic control simulation – involves reproducing real-life flight scenarios which include runway take offs, air scenes and also weather conditions.